On Education.com, preschool recycled crafts and life science activities combine creativity and environmental awareness by making art and practical objects from everyday trash. These activities teach children about nature, recycling, and sustainability while encouraging hands-on learning. Examples include creating planters from egg cartons, building bird feeders from milk jugs, and making bug habitats from bottle caps. These crafts provide a fun and eco-friendly way to explore science concepts while promoting recycling habits.
